I found this cool site, where we can put ourselves (literally) on a world map to see where we all are!!!

We're such an international community, and growing so quickly, it'll be so fun.

So click on this link, http://www.frappr.com/?a=constellati...id=68719952642 click on ADD, fill in your particulars, and you'd be added to the map!!

Let's see how quickly we can fill up the world map!!!